c语言编程 这个题目的x,y,z的取值范围怎么求出来的?

如题所述

x=100/5=20
y=100/3=33
z<=100
也就是说由钱数和鸡的总数共同限制追问

这跟鸡的总数有什么关系?

追答

z的取值范围由鸡的总数确定,否则是300

追问

z<=99呀?

追答

z要是3的倍数。。。

温馨提示:内容为网友见解,仅供参考
无其他回答

c语言编程 这个题目的x,y,z的取值范围怎么求出来的?
x=100\/5=20 y=100\/3=33 z<=100 也就是说由钱数和鸡的总数共同限制

用C语言编写程序,计算下算式中X、Y、Z的值。 X Y Z + Y Z Z
y,z=%d,%d,%d\\n", x, y, z); return; }}

...编写程序,接受用户从键盘上输入的三个整数x,y,z,从中选出最大和最...
void main(){ int x,y,z;scanf("%d%d%d",&x,&y,&z);printf("最大:%d\\n最小:%d\\n",x>y?(x>z?x:z):(y>z?y:z),x<y?(x<z?x:z):(y<z?y:z));} 哪里不懂Q我:281754179

百鸡问题怎么用C语言求解
1)x的取值范围为1~20 2)y的取值范围为1~33 3)z的取值范围为3~99,步长为3 对于这个问题我们可以用穷举的方法,遍历x,y,z的所有可能组合,最后得到问题的解。数据要求 问题中的常量:无 问题的输入:无 问题的输出:int x,y,z \/*公鸡、母鸡、小鸡的只数*\/ 初始算法 1.初始化为1;2...

用C语言编程:从键盘输入三个不相同的数,在屏幕输出最大数。
三个数x,y,z输出最大数,可以先比较x和y把最大值赋值给x,接着比较x和z,把最大值赋值给x,输出x即可。参考代码:include "stdio.h"int main(){ int x,y,z;scanf("%d%d%d",&x,&y,&z);if(x<y)x=y;if(x<z)x=z; printf("最大数为:%d",x); return 0;}\/*运行...

C语言,请问这个程序z是怎么算的哦,看不懂
x+=y,相当于x=x+y,x赋值15,x\/y,即15\/5,结果为3 逗号表达式是从左向右执行,整个数值就是最右侧表达式的值,z被赋值3,并输出,结果选D

用C语言编写一个3元1次方程式的解 该怎么编写 好像顺序选择和循环都不...
x,y,z的取值范围,你得规定一下。假设均是【0,200】: #include<stdio.h> include<stdlib.h> main(){ int x,y,z;for(x=0;x<=200;x++){ for(y=0;y<=200;y++){ for(z=0;z<=200;z++){ if(((int)((2\/3.0)*x+(3\/2.0)*y+(1\/18.0)*z))==100)&&((x+y+z)=...

c语言:x=y=1;z=x++,y++,++y;计算输出x,y,z的值
x=1,y=1 z=x++ 把x给z,所以z=1,之后x++,所以x=2;y++ 原来y=1,现在变成2 ++y 前面y=2,现在变成3 所以,最后:x=2 y=3 x=1

C语言计算。设x=4,y=8.说明下列运算后,x,y,z的值分别是多少?
x==5,y==7,z==35;x==5,y==7,z==12;x++表示后增预算,即先使用X,之后在做++运算,假设X=4,y=x++;这时候就是先把x的值赋给y,在做++运算,执行完后,结果为y==4,x==5;++x表示后增运算,即先做++运算,在使用x,还是假设x=4,y=++x;这时候就是x先自增加1,在把值赋给y...

当x=y=z=0时,c语言中++x || ++y && ++z; x ,y,z的值是多少
1||(++y&&++z)三、 根据短路运算,当||左值为1时,右值是1还是0已经不影响最终结果了。所以右值不参运算 于是右侧的++y&&++z不会被执行。 y和z还是原始值0.四、 综上, 执行后x=1, y=0, z=0.五、 编写如下程序验证:include <stdio.h>int main(){ int x, y, z;x=y=z=0;...

相似回答